I have been using a great enzyme-based drain cleaner for years called DrainCare.
You just run warm water in the drain, pour in the DrainCare per directions, let it eat overnight and then flush it down with hot water. I always start the flushing process with a kettle of boiling water. Leaves the pipes clean as a whistle.
It eats out all organic gunk, grease, hair, soap scum, etc., and easily opens up hard to snake drains like bathtubs. It won't harm your fixtures or pipes at all.
Any time that any drain gets sluggish, I hit it with DrainCare and it opens right up. Sometimes, if someone has a badly clogged drain, they may have to use it more than once, but it always works.
It is much safer than Drano and other dangerous caustic chemicals, which I have not used in years after I discovered DrainCare (available at big box stores, etc.)
